How did the Japanese get their surnames?
Japanese surnames originated from the surname system in the 4th century, which was divided into surname, surname, Miao character, and first name. Both the surname and the surname were conferred titles. The surname was formed by people with the same blood relationship or the same occupation, and the surname was the title given to the surname to express its social and political status. The Miao word was the name of a blood group that had the same ancestor, which was also the current surname. In ancient times, only nobles and warriors could have surnames. The most distinguished surnames were the Yuan, Ping, Teng, and Ju surnames. In the middle of the 7th century, the Great Transformation abolished hereditary titles and mixed surnames with surnames. Some of them became the current surnames, but surnames were still exclusive to nobles at that time. In the 19th century, surnames were limited to warriors, merchants, and powerful people in the village. It was not until 1870 that the Meiji government issued a decree to force civilians to take surnames to facilitate household registration management and conscription, so civilians began to take their own surnames. There were many sources of surnames, many of which were based on the place name (such as living on the side of the mountain, the surname may be Yamamoto), the occupation (such as raising a dog, the surname may be raised), the surrounding environment of the residence (there are pine trees near the home, the surname may be Matsushita), and many other random methods. After the Household Registration Law was enacted in 1898, the surname of each household was fixed. Shopping in the supermarket, playing games, teaching plans, reflecting on the advantages and disadvantages of the middle class
The following is a reflection example of the advantages and disadvantages of the self-directed game lesson plan for the middle class: ** 1. Strengths ** 1. ** In terms of achieving goals ** - From the perspective of knowledge and skills, by letting the children play the roles of salesperson and customer, the children could understand the supermarket shopping process in the game, such as selecting goods, paying, etc., and have a more intuitive understanding of the functions and shopping methods of the supermarket. For example, in role-playing, children learned to classify and place goods according to the types of goods, such as food and daily necessities, which helped to improve their cognitive ability and common sense. - In terms of emotional attitude, the children experienced the joy of shopping in the process of independent play, and at the same time, they could cultivate their sense of cooperation. When children played different roles, they needed to communicate and cooperate with each other to complete the shopping game, such as the interaction between the customer and the salesperson, and the discussion between the customers about what to buy. 2. ** Teaching Method Usage ** - Using role-playing was a very suitable teaching method for middle-class children. The children in the middle class were at the stage where they had rich imagination and liked to imitate. Letting them play the role in the supermarket could fully mobilize their enthusiasm and initiative. They could freely use their imagination and carry out shopping activities according to their own understanding. This kind of autonomy was helpful for the development of children's personality. - The game-based teaching method made the learning process easy and enjoyable. Shopping in the supermarket was a scene that children might come into contact with in their lives. Turning it into a game was easier for children to accept. For example, when setting up a small supermarket corner, the moment the child entered the area, it was as if he was in a real supermarket. This kind of situation creation made the child more involved in the game, and thus unconsciously learned knowledge. 3. ** Event content design ** - The content had a certain degree of life and practicality. The supermarket was a common place in children's daily life. The independent game lesson plan with the theme of shopping in the supermarket allowed children to learn life-related knowledge in the game, such as recognizing the types of goods, price tags, etc. This would help young children connect what they have learned with the reality of life and improve their ability to adapt to life. - The activity was more expansive. The lesson plan could further expand the content after the child was familiar with the basic shopping process, such as adding promotional activities (discounts, buy one get one free, etc.), handling customer complaints, etc. This could continuously enrich the game content and meet the learning needs of the child at different stages. ** 2. Weakness ** 1. ** Not enough attention to individual differences ** - During the game, some children might be more active, while others might not participate. For example, introverted children might not dare to take the initiative to play the role of a salesperson to communicate with customers, or they might be more passive when choosing goods. Teachers may not have fully considered how to guide children with different personalities and abilities in the design of lesson plans to ensure that every child can be fully developed in the game. 2. ** Rule Setting ** - The rules of the game, such as payment methods (cash, card, mobile payment, etc.), might not be set up carefully enough. In modern supermarkets, there were various payment methods, and the lesson plan might only briefly mention the traditional cash payment method, which might lead to a lack of comprehensive understanding of modern supermarket shopping. Moreover, the rules for special situations such as damaged goods, returns, and so on might not be involved, which affected the degree of reproduction of the real supermarket scene in the game. 3. ** Limitations of the depth of education ** - Although children learned the basic shopping process and product classification in the game, they were less involved in some deep economic concepts such as price comparison and cost-performance ratio. This might limit children's further understanding of mathematical and economic concepts in supermarket shopping. Reading notes, reflection on how to write a grade one student after the exam
After the first year of junior high school students wrote their reading notes, they could start from the following aspects: ** I. Review of the overall reading situation ** 1. ** Number of views ** - Think about whether you have read enough books before the exam. For example, whether or not they had completed the corresponding reading tasks according to the teacher's or the curriculum standards. If the amount of reading was insufficient, it might lead to a lack of material and knowledge reserves in reading comprehension questions or questions related to reading notes. 2. ** Reading depth ** - He was testing his understanding of the books he had read. Was it just a superficial understanding of the plot, or was it able to dig deep into the theme, character, writing technique, and so on? For example, when reading some classic literary works, did you understand the deeper meaning that the author wanted to convey, such as the understanding of the various expressions of "love" in "The Education of Love"? ** 2. The content of the book notes ** 1. ** Record accuracy ** - Check if you have recorded the key information in the book (such as the names of the characters, the order of important events, etc.) accurately when you are taking notes. If you made a mistake in the exam because of a mistake in your reading notes, this was the part that needed to be reflected on. 2. ** Focus on grasping ** - He was thinking about whether he could accurately grasp the key content of the book and take notes. For example, when reading biographies, one could grasp the main deeds and achievements of the biography. For example, when reading about Yue Fei's biography, one could focus on recording Yue Fei's military achievements and the key plot of his being framed. 3. ** Complete content ** - He checked if his notes were complete and if he had missed out any important elements. For example, when recording the novel, apart from the plot, whether or not the description of the novel's environment and the author's writing purpose were neglected. ** 3. The relationship between exam performance and reading notes ** 1. ** Reading Comprehension Questions ** - If you lose more points on the reading comprehension questions, analyze whether it is because you didn't take good reading notes, resulting in a lack of in-depth understanding of the article. For example, when reading some foreign literary works, due to the difference in cultural background, if the reading notes did not organize the relevant cultural background knowledge, it might affect the understanding of the article. 2. ** Relationship between writing questions and reading notes ** - In terms of writing questions, he reflected on whether he could apply the materials in his reading notes to his essay. For example, when writing an essay about the character's quality, whether he could find suitable examples of characters from books he had read as evidence. If he couldn't, he wondered if it was because the book notes didn't have an in-depth analysis of the character's quality, or if he lacked the ability to transfer and apply the material. ** IV. Modification measures ** 1. ** The improvement of reading habits ** - Plan to increase your reading volume. You can make a reading plan, which will specify the number and types of books you want to read every week or month. For example, he would read a classic literary work and a popular science book every month. - When reading, you should pay more attention to in-depth understanding. You can use annotations, discussions with classmates or teachers to deepen your understanding of the book. 2. ** Perfection of reading notes ** - Increase the accuracy of the notes, be more careful in the reading process, and verify the uncertain content in time. - Learning to better grasp the key points of the book, one could first read the book's foreword, table of contents, and other parts to understand the key content of the book in advance, and then take notes during the reading process. At the same time, pay attention to the completeness of the notes and record as much important information related to the book as possible. 3. ** Knowledge utilization ability improved ** - To strengthen the memory and understanding of the materials in the reading notes, so that they can be used flexibly in the exam writing and other aspects.
